City to host public meeting on tax abatement for residential construction
The city of Des Moines will host a public meeting on Aug. 9 about tax abatement for new residential construction and residential improvements.
The city’s tax abatement arrangement will expire on Dec. 31, and the council is seeking public input regarding the proposed ordinance for the future. City staff will make short presentations at 5:30 p.m. and 7 p.m. at city council chambers in City Hall, 400 Robert D. Ray Drive, and will allow for public input before and after the presentations.
